In recent decades, authors affiliated with Capital Medical University have published 67.9k papers, which have received a total of 1.0M indexed citations. Scholars at this organization have produced 13.8k papers in Molecular Biology, 11.1k papers in Surgery and 11.0k papers in Epidemiology on the topics of Acute Ischemic Stroke Management (2.1k papers), Cerebrovascular and Carotid Artery Diseases (1.9k papers) and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(1.8k pap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Molecular Biology (260.5k citations), Epidemiology (142.7k citations) and Surgery (114.8k citations). Authors at Capital Medical University collaborate with scholars in China, United States and Australia and have published in prestigious journals including Nature, Science and Cell. Some of Capital Medical University's most productive authors include Yongjun Wang, Xunming Ji, Yu‐Tao Xiang, Kuncheng Li, Jost B. Jonas, Luo Zhang, Wenjie Tan, Bin Cao, Guizhen Wu and Roujian Lu.
